#pragma once

#include "ExceptionOr.h"
#include "NodeFilter.h"
#include "ScriptWrappable.h"
#include "Traversal.h"

namespace WebCore {

class NodeIterator : public ScriptWrappable, public RefCounted<NodeIterator>, public NodeIteratorBase {
public:
    static Ref<NodeIterator> create(Node&, unsigned whatToShow, RefPtr<NodeFilter>&&);
    WEBCORE_EXPORT ~NodeIterator();

    WEBCORE_EXPORT ExceptionOr<RefPtr<Node>> nextNode();
    WEBCORE_EXPORT ExceptionOr<RefPtr<Node>> previousNode();
    void detach() { } // This is now a no-op as per the DOM specification.

    Node* referenceNode() const { return m_referenceNode.node.get(); }
    bool pointerBeforeReferenceNode() const { return m_referenceNode.isPointerBeforeNode; }

    // This function is called before any node is removed from the document tree.
    void nodeWillBeRemoved(Node&);

private:
    NodeIterator(Node&, unsigned whatToShow, RefPtr<NodeFilter>&&);

    struct NodePointer {
        RefPtr<Node> node;
        bool isPointerBeforeNode { true };

        NodePointer() = default;
        NodePointer(Node&, bool);

        void clear();
        bool moveToNext(Node& root);
        bool moveToPrevious(Node& root);
    };

    void updateForNodeRemoval(Node& nodeToBeRemoved, NodePointer&) const;

    NodePointer m_referenceNode;
    NodePointer m_candidateNode;
};

} // namespace WebCore
